Ordinary, Reasonable Chatbots: Do AI Models Track Human Legal Judgments?

Read the original on arXiv AI →

The paper investigates whether large language model (LLM) chatbots can emulate human legal judgments of reasonableness. By comparing responses from 26 LLMs to those of human participants across 25 legal scenarios, the study finds that chatbots generally track human answers but tend to produce more homogeneous, government‑ and corporation‑friendly responses and align more closely with white, male, older, and more educated respondents. The authors note that these patterns warrant further systematic research.

When Does Defendant Statement Matter? A Study of Bias and Persuasion in LLM-Simulated Jurors

The paper investigates how a defendant’s courtroom statement influences decisions made by large language model (LLM)–simulated jurors. Using the newly introduced JuryBench benchmark, the authors analyze 432,000 verdicts from 20 frontier LLMs, varying defendant background, emotional appeal, and rebuttal content. Results show that emotional persuasion can backfire, that jurors are harsher toward defendants from different backgrounds and more lenient toward same‑background defendants, and that juror ideology strongly shapes verdict severity.
